21.6. 2024 item No.141 n.b.

ct. no. 24 WPA 6295 of 2018 Chandeshwar Prasad Vs.

Union of India & Ors.

Mr. Bipul Kumar Mandal, .... For the UOI.

None appears on behalf of the petitioner.

It is submitted by the learned advocate for the respondent that he appeared on the earlier occasion but the order was not correctly made to that effect. Accordingly order dated 14.6.2024 is hereby corrected to the effect that the learned advocate Mr. Bipul Kumar Mandal represented on behalf of the Union of India before this Court on 14.6.2024.

Learned advocate for the respondent submits that the instant matter became infructuous as the petitioner has already retired from his service.

It appears that the petitioner has challenged the order of inter-battalion periodical transfer from Chattaranjan to Dhanbad issued by the respondent on March 28, 2018. One ad interim relief was granted in favour of the petitioner. Now, this matter appears before this Court after six years.

Considering the submission of the learned advocate for the respondent that the present petitioner has already

been retired from his service, it appears to me that the instant matter become infructuous. However, the petitioner is not present. Accordingly, the instant matter is hereby dismissed for default.

Any interim order passed by this Court on the earlier occasion is hereby also vacated.
